From Tehran's tightening grip on the Strait of Hormuz to the latest drone innovations by Hezbollah in Lebanon, we've got all the updates you need to understand the shifting power dynamics. Iran continues to rebuild its missile capabilities after the US and Israeli strikes, and the strategic importance of Hormuz is more central than ever. Tankers are still navigating under Iran's selective control, while Gulf states are improvising with overland logistics to keep vital supplies moving.  We also cover the evolving stance of Gulf nations.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, and the UAE are showing they're willing to push back against Iran-linked militias, conducting airstrikes, arrests, and intelligence operations to protect their borders and economic interests. Israel is reinforcing the UAE with Iron Dome batteries and personnel, highlighting a regional security partnership that's quietly deepening while remaining politically sensitive.  Over in Gaza, we update you on the delicate situation with Hamas. The high representative to the US-led Board of Peace warns that unless the group disarms and hands over military control, the current status quo could solidify into a permanent division of the territory. Israel's territorial expansion and limitations on humanitarian access are complicating recovery efforts, and the lives of civilians remain under extreme strain.  Hezbollah continues to innovate with fiber-optic first-person-view drones that are low-cost, hard to jam, and deadly precise. These small drones are creating asymmetric challenges for Israel, forcing rapid adaptation in counter-drone strategies and production of new defensive systems.  We also touch on international angles that matter. China is reportedly discussing covert arms transfers to Iran, raising questions about global power calculations and the delicate diplomacy around US-China relations. Defense-industrial developments are underway too. Israel is extending F-35 range with new external fuel tanks, and the UAE's EDGE group is expanding into Europe with the acquisition of Italy's CMD, boosting long-term capabilities in aerospace, military vehicles, and marine systems.  This episode is packed with insight, giving you a clear picture of how Iran, the Gulf states, Israel, Hezbollah, and even China are moving their pieces on this complex geopolitical chessboard.
